The mosquito must bite the patient during the first three days of the fever; after that a yellow fever patient cannot infect a mosquito. A period of twelve days must elapse before the mosquito is able to infect another person. After that she may infect anyone she may bite; that is, the germs remain virulent during the rest of the mosquito's life.
